Chicago, Oct. 1. - The Loaguo base ball ;ison has cíosod with Baltimoro at tlia huad of the class, and that club will consequently fly the pennant for i,hc coming year. New York is secoad and Boston third. Chicago managed to cling to sigh'h plaoe with a gort of death grip and Loulsvllle winds up the proccssion with a percentage of only SQ.
